The Sound Blaster Z PCIe sound card is one of the most popular sound cards on the market. It is a great sound card for gamers, music lovers, and PC enthusiasts. The card delivers crystal clear audio and offers a variety of features and functionality.
The Sound Blaster Z PCIe sound card is based on the Sound Core3D audio processor. This processor delivers Dolby Digital Live and DTS Connect encoding, which allows you to enjoy 5.1 surround sound audio from your PC. The card also features a 106dB signal-to-noise ratio, which ensures that you will enjoy crystal clear audio quality.
The Sound Blaster Z also comes with a variety of features that are designed to make your gaming experience more enjoyable. These features include Scout Mode, which allows you to hear enemies and objects that are further away from you, and CrystalVoice, which ensures that your voice will be heard clearly in all of your gaming communications.
The card also features a variety of other features that are designed to make your music listening experience more enjoyable. These features include THX TruStudio Pro, which ensures that you will enjoy studio-quality audio, and SBX Pro Studio, which allows you to customize your audio experience.
The Sound Blaster Z PCIe sound card is a great choice for PC enthusiasts and gamers who are looking for an audio card that delivers high-quality audio. The card offers a variety of features and functionality that will make your audio experience more enjoyable.

A sound card is a piece of computer hardware that allows your computer to produce sound. It connects to your computer’s motherboard and allows you to output audio through your speakers or headphones.
If you are using a desktop computer, you probably need a sound card. Most desktop motherboards come with a sound card built in, but the quality of the sound card may not be very good. If you are using a laptop, you may not need a sound card. Some laptops come with a sound card built in, but many do not.
If you are using a desktop computer and you are not happy with the quality of the sound, you may want to consider purchasing a sound card.
